How Our Team Handles Skylight Leak Water Removal
With skylight leak water removal, our team takes a meticulous approach to ensure that every inch of affected area is thoroughly dried and restored. We understand that a proper process is crucial in preventing further damage and ensuring your property is safe and secure. You can’t afford to cut corners with water damage, or you risk facing costly repairs down the line.
Step 1: Assessment and Inspection
Our technicians will conduct a thorough assessment of the affected area to identify the source of the leak and find out the best course of action. We’ll use specialized equipment to detect any hidden moisture and assess the extent of the damage.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use industrial-strength pumps and wet vacuums to extract as much water as possible from the affected area. This helps prevent further damage and reduces the risk of mold and mildew growth.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ll employ advanced drying techniques and equipment to remove any remaining moisture from the affected area. This may involve the use of desiccants, dehumidifiers, or other specialized tools.
Step 4: Repair and Restoration
Once the area is dry, our technicians will repair any damaged skylights, roofing, or structural parts. We’ll also conduct any necessary cleaning and disinfecting to ensure your property is safe and healthy.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Certification
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ure that the affected area is completely dry and free from any signs of moisture. We’ll also provide you with a certification of completion and a detailed report outlining the work we’ve done.

Skylight Leak Water Removal Cost In Dunwoody, GA
The cost of skylight leak water removal in Dunwoody, GA can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ide you with a detailed estimate based on your specific situation.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Assessment and Inspection | $100 – $500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
| Water Extraction and Drying | $500 – $2,500 | Amount of water extracted, equipment used |
| Repair and Restoration | $1,000 – $5,000 | Extent of damage, materials required |
| Final Inspection and Certification | $100 – $500 | Complexity of the job, equipment used |
